57,312,806,055,831 is an odd compos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 57312806055831 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 4 prime factors (large circles) and 24 divisors.

57312806055831 is an odd compos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 57312806055831:

32 × 563 × 577 × 19603109

(3 × 3 × 563 × 577 × 19603109)
